Skip to main content

🪺 Vendor-neutral agent broker, Feishu-native. 飞书原生的多 Agent 中立接入器。

Project description

🪺 Roostery

A roost for your agent flock — vendor-neutral agent broker, Feishu-native.

飞书原生的多 Agent 中立接入器。让任意 agent runtime(OpenClaw / Claude Code / Codex / Cursor / Gemini ...)在飞书生态里栖息、协作、被监督。


状态

🚧 筹划期 / Planning Phase(2026-05-15)

本仓库正在筹备开源。Spec 与实现尚未公开。欢迎围观。

核心定位

  • vendor-neutral:任意 agent runtime / 任意 LLM provider,皆可接入
  • Feishu-native:飞书 Base / IM / 画板 / 任务 作为天然呈现层 + 数据底
  • local-first:本地 daemon 主导调度,数据留在用户飞书租户
  • developer-priority:code-defined workflow(yaml/Python),非 GUI 拖拽
  • MIT licensed:开源,自托管

跟谁错位

类别 已有产品 Roostery
通用 agent dashboard builderz-labs/mission-control 飞书原生 UI 复用
Canvas 多线程 agent NoteLoom / Flowith / jaaz 数据不假于人,飞书租户内闭环
Agent runtime OpenClaw / Claude Code / Codex / Cursor 不造 runtime,做中立接入
商业 SaaS AgentCenter / Manus 自托管 + 数据主权

引擎

  • 多 Agent runtime adapter(首批:OpenClaw / Claude Code / Codex / Gemini / Python custom)
  • 多 LLM provider router
  • 多形态入口并行(IM chat / Base 字段改写 / 画板 / 任务卡片 / CLI / HTTP)
  • launchd / systemd 本地守护
  • agent 行为级审计

License

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

roostery-0.0.0.tar.gz (3.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

roostery-0.0.0-py3-none-any.whl (3.5 kB view details)

Uploaded Python 3

File details

Details for the file roostery-0.0.0.tar.gz.

File metadata

  • Download URL: roostery-0.0.0.tar.gz
  • Upload date:
  • Size: 3.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.5

File hashes

Hashes for roostery-0.0.0.tar.gz
Algorithm Hash digest
SHA256 493fcbc289f65360800254fea0d2c46258cac5c6079cba2d4cba8547a6f9ba26
MD5 0972bc051730426a3f9f0f3d303b9320
BLAKE2b-256 50c7b7362fe691f69db18ac26077eff85b47d692aed77a8801ae466a0be6e2e6

See more details on using hashes here.

File details

Details for the file roostery-0.0.0-py3-none-any.whl.

File metadata

  • Download URL: roostery-0.0.0-py3-none-any.whl
  • Upload date:
  • Size: 3.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.14.5

File hashes

Hashes for roostery-0.0.0-py3-none-any.whl
Algorithm Hash digest
SHA256 cc560970bde5cf36f8f79ad6663abe7b14433c06d10f14df24fa9d72b1b2a255
MD5 88377b4f519b188303e091d553e00248
BLAKE2b-256 177c2e1257929b11a2c134e6baa456e7b6698465a577f5308c39b161122a8004

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page